The Joe Perry concert scheduled for Saturday, April 5, at the Seneca Allegany Casino and Hotel has been canceled.
Perry, lead guitarist for Aerosmith, is to undergo knee surgery and must cancel some of his tour dates, casino officials said in an announcement today. Tickets for the performance can be refunded at the original point of purchase. - more on this story
